EM.Tempo offers the following types of observable:
* '''[[FDTD_Observable_Types#Probing_Fields_in_Time_and_Frequency_Domains|Field Probe]]''' for monitoring E- and H-field components at a fixed location in both time and frequency domains. * '''[[FDTD_Observable_Types#Frequency-Domain_Near_Field_Visualization|Field Sensor]]''' for monitoring E- and H-field components on a cross section of the computational domain in both time and frequency domains.* '''[[FDTD_Observable_Types#Far_Field_Calculations_in_FDTD|Far Field Radiation Pattern]]''' for monitoring the radiation behavior of your structure.* '''[[FDTD_Observable_Types#Radar_Cross_Section|Far Field RCS]]''' for monitoring the scattering behavior of your structure.
* '''Huygens Surface''' for collecting tangential field data on a box.
* '''[[FDTD_Observable_Types#Scattering_Parameters_and_Port_Characteristics|Port Definition]]''' for calculating the S/Y/Z [[parameters]] and voltage standing wave ratio (VSWR).
* '''Domain Energy''' for calculating the total electric and magnetic energy in the computational domain.
* '''Periodic Characteristics''' for calculating the reflection and transmission coefficients when your periodic structure is excited by a plane wave source.
